As organizations scale, financial audits often shift from a routine process to a high-stress, time-consuming exercise. This was the reality for a fast-growing company operating in a regulated environment, where manual controls and fragmented systems made audit preparation increasingly complex and risky.

By introducing continuous financial controls and real-time visibility into transactions, the company transformed audits from a reactive scramble into a predictable, low-effort process.

The Challenge

The finance team faced mounting pressure each audit cycle. Transaction data lived across multiple tools, approvals were handled manually, and policy enforcement relied heavily on after-the-fact reviews.

Key challenges included:

  • Manual evidence collection for auditors across spreadsheets, emails, and PDFs

  • Limited visibility into who approved what—and when

  • Inconsistent enforcement of spending and payment policies

  • Last-minute audit preparation that pulled finance teams away from strategic work

Audits routinely took weeks of preparation, increased the risk of compliance gaps, and placed unnecessary strain on both finance and operations teams.

The Solution

To address these issues, the company implemented a finance management platform designed around continuous controls rather than periodic checks.

Real-Time Policy Enforcement

Spending and payment policies were embedded directly into daily workflows. Transactions were automatically checked against predefined rules before approval or execution, ensuring compliance by default.

Automated Approval & Audit Trails

Every transaction included a clear, time-stamped approval history. Auditors could instantly trace who approved expenses, why they were approved, and whether they complied with policy—without manual follow-ups.

Centralized Documentation

Receipts, invoices, approvals, and transaction metadata were automatically attached and stored in one system, eliminating the need for manual document collection during audits.

Continuous Monitoring & Alerts

Instead of discovering issues weeks later, the finance team received real-time alerts for anomalies, exceptions, or policy breaches, allowing issues to be resolved immediately.

The Result

The shift to continuous financial controls had an immediate and measurable impact:

  • 70% reduction in audit preparation time

  • Fewer audit findings and follow-up requests

  • Improved confidence from external auditors

  • Finance teams reclaimed weeks of time each quarter

Audits became a validation step rather than a disruptive event, allowing finance leaders to focus on forecasting, strategy, and growth.

From Reactive to Always Audit-Ready

By embedding controls directly into financial workflows, the company moved from reactive compliance to continuous audit readiness. Instead of preparing for audits a few times a year, they now operate in a state of constant readiness—reducing risk while increasing operational efficiency.

This approach not only simplified audits but also strengthened overall financial governance, setting a foundation for scalable, compliant growth.
